> > Hi,
> > I'm using NCU on the Mac (OS 7.5.5) to backup my 2100. All is well until
>it
> > starts the package backup. When it gets to Vea, NCU just hangs and the
> > subsequently, the Newton loses its connection, then my Powerbook
>freezes.
> > Strange thing is, Vea is not on my Newton as a package, nor are there
>any
> > associated soups (I checked via Soup Sweep on both stores). Any idea
>what
> > else could be causing the hangup?
>
>It's possible that there is still an entry in your Packages soup for Vea
>that
>is corrupt. The Packages soup is sort of a meta-Soup: you can't see it
>directly from the Extras folder, but you can use the Packages or Soup
>Editor
>functions of SBM Utilities to look at the package soup.
